Obama discusses IranIan nuclear deal with leaders of Bahrain, Qatar, Kuwait and UAE
Read on the website Vestnik KavkazaUS President Barack Obama discussed the details of the "political framework agreement" reached in Lausanne aimed at resolving the Iranian nuclear issue with the leaders of Bahrain, Qatar, Kuwait and the UAE, the press service of the White House reported.
He confirmed that Washington's approach to the arrangements of the five permanent UN Security Council members and Germany with Iran remains the same: "Nothing is agreed until everything is agreed." The coming months will be used by the 5+1 group to modify "the technical details of a durable, comprehensive solution" of the Iranian nuclear issue. Such a decision should "ensure the peaceful nature of Iran's nuclear program" on a test basis, Obama said
